TECHNIQUES FOR SUPER-MODE OSCILLATION.

Abstract

This report describes an experimental and theoretical program to determine the fundamental properties of the FM and super-mode lasers. These two techniques make it possible to obtain at a single frequency the full power of a high-power multimode laser without suffering the loss in power inherent in conventional approaches involving the suppression of modes. The work of this program is divided broadly between two main activities. The first is to obtain a more complete understanding of the physics governing the operation of the FM and super-mode lasers. The second is concerned with improving the techniques for coupling the modes of the FM laser and finding more efficient means for full power super-mode conversion of the FM signal to a monochromatic output.
